Responsible for safeguarding and ethical accounting of the Kearney location's assets in conformance with Generally Accepted Accounting Principles. Provide leadership and guidance to manage the business using the Win Strategy. Ensure compliance to Corporate/Division policies and compliance in accounting as it relates to Cost Accounting Standards (CAS).
Functions include: Fixed Assets, general ledger, budgeting, financial planning, internal control oversights (Sarbanes Oxley), financial reporting both internal and external, and performance measurements.
Under the direction of the Division Controller, supervise accounting functions to assure that all inventory costs are properly stated. This position requires frequent interface with the managers and supervisors at all levels of the organization from group, division and local staff functions on topics of accounting, internal control issues and business-related topics
